This book discusses the operations of various types of financial institutions operating in Singapore. These include the full-license, restricted-license and offshore banks, merchant banks, money broking firms, finance companies, insurance and reinsurance companies. The author analyzes the activities in the financial markets which comprise the capital market, the money market, the Asian Dollar Market, the Asian Bond Market, the stock market, the financial futures market, the gold market and the foreign exchange market. The roles of the Monetary Authority of Singapore, the DBS Bank, the POS Bank, the Central Provident Fund and other government institutions are examined and the latest developments in the financial futures market, Singapore Commodities Market (SICOM), Simex, SESDAQ and the Central Provident Fund are also included. The tenth edition includes financial reforms in Singapore and the latest liberalization plan for the banking industry.
